Subject: [PATCH 1/6] pwm: sun4i: enable clk prior to getting its rate

Ensure the PWM clock is enabled prior to retrieving its rate, as is
already being done in sun4i_pwm_apply.

Signed-off-by: Roman Beranek <roman.beranek@prusa3d.com>
---
 drivers/pwm/pwm-sun4i.c | 7 +++++++
 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/pwm/pwm-sun4i.c b/drivers/pwm/pwm-sun4i.c
index e01becd102c0..3721b9894cf6 100644
--- a/drivers/pwm/pwm-sun4i.c
+++ b/drivers/pwm/pwm-sun4i.c
@@ -117,8 +117,15 @@ static void sun4i_pwm_get_state(struct pwm_chip *chip,
 	u64 clk_rate, tmp;
 	u32 val;
 	unsigned int prescaler;
+	int ret;
 
+	ret = clk_prepare_enable(sun4i_pwm->clk);
+	if (ret) {
+		dev_err(chip->dev, "failed to enable PWM clock\n");
+		return;
+	}
 	clk_rate = clk_get_rate(sun4i_pwm->clk);
+	clk_disable_unprepare(sun4i_pwm->clk);
 
 	val = sun4i_pwm_readl(sun4i_pwm, PWM_CTRL_REG);
